Transaction 62a989ffe76df8a4f688a3e70b10316e037e525159fb4658ff6ae4e89226874b

2 Input
2 Outputs
  • 62a989ffe76df8a4f688a3e70b10316e037e525159fb4658ff6ae4e89226874b:0
  • value  100000000
    address  15Trkw2oepviFqTY7CRn5JofFz4LWU7cqA
  • 62a989ffe76df8a4f688a3e70b10316e037e525159fb4658ff6ae4e89226874b:1
  • value  201460020
    address  13fcE2fU8TpLVpnnUwkxKNTW44TNyjdw1k